Summers in New York can be extremely hot, and the city is taking steps to reduce the temperatures inside buildings through a program that most New Yorkers don't even see. Since 2009, New York City has used more than 9.2 million square feet of paint in free roof upgrades to nonprofits, hospitals, and affordable housing
